Queens, NY Bicycle Accident Statistics

According to New York City Department of Transportation (NYCDOT) data, 836 bicyclists were injured in Queens in 2018. Three Queens crashes caused bicyclist fatalities. Citywide, more than 4,300 New Yorkers were injured in bicycle accidents that occurred in a single year.

Although the statistics can be shocking, they aren’t entirely surprising. Ridership is up across the city with the introduction of Citi Bike rentals and more than 300 miles of new bicycle lanes. As of October 2019, the city had more than 1,250 miles of bicycle lanes–40% of which are considered “protected.”

The uptick in building dedicated bike lanes was, of course, motivated by a surge in bicycle accident injuries and fatalities.

Time to Act is Limited

You’re required to make a claim for compensation within the applicable limits specified by law. However, some insurance policies require you to make a claim much sooner than the three-year personal injury statute of limitations.

Because New York is a no-fault insurance state, you’ll likely make a claim against someone’s insurance policy if a negligent driver caused your accident. If the transit authorities or a government agency is responsible, you have only 90 days to file a notice of claim with the city.

What If the Accident Was Partly My Fault?

You don’t lose your right to financial compensation even if you were partly to blame for the accident. Instead, your damages award is reduced in proportion to the percentage of fault attributed to your actions. New York follows a pure comparative negligence law, which means that you can get compensation even if you share some of the blame for your accident and injuries. That’s true, even if you’re 99% at fault.

A simple example can illustrate. Assume that, through negotiations, we reach an agreement that you were 30% to blame for the accident. If our negotiated settlement with the insurance company was $100,000, your award will be reduced by 30%. You’ll still be entitled to $70,000 in damages.

How Much Money Can I Get If I Was Hurt in a New York City Bicycle Accident?

Every case is different. If your injuries were serious or permanent, you’ll generally be entitled to a higher compensation award. Our lawyers will work to get the full amount that you deserve to cover:

  • Medical bills
  • Lost wages 
  • Future medical care
  • Reduced earning potential
  • Physical therapy
  • Rehabilitation
  • Long-term care
  • Disfigurement and scarring
  • Pain and suffering
  • Emotional distress
  • Loss of enjoyment of life
  • Loss of your loved one’s company or support if the accident resulted in wrongful death
  • Damage to your bicycle or property
  • And more
